Features

Also Known as Tiger Jaws, Shark's Jaws.
Habit Rosettes of fleshy, triangular shaped leaves. Leaves have teeth on their margins. Masses to form a very alien looking clump.
Height Clumping masses can get as tall as 30cm.
Colour Dark green foliage which develops a grey hue as it ages.
Flowers Bright yellow, daisy like flowers appear mainly in autumn. However it can spot flower throughout the year.
Aspect Prefers a part shade position.
Uses Great in potted arrangements or on its own in a pot. Large clumps look amazing in low bowls, especially when they flower.
